Conf.
PAI
:
Recursos
Parceiros
Projeto
Empreendedor
Cliente
Índice
Colabore
Contato:
carlos
apoie.org
|
leandro
apoie.org
Diagrama Sintático - Convenções do desenho
Elementos, Formas de percurso e Exemplo.
1
. Exemplo
Ruby 1.9.1 - if
Python 3.0 if_stmt
2
. Exemplo com legenda
Ruby 1.9.1 - if
Python 3.0 if_stmt
Legenda
Início válido
Sequência
Alternativa
Repetição
Final válido
Exatamente o que está escrito dentro
Definido em outro lugar
3
. Formas de percurso
Sequência
Alternativa
Repetição
Percurso válido
: de seta inicial até um final válido. Seta inicial não tem elemento anterior.
4
. Definição dos elementos
Diagramas Sintáticos - desenhos utilizados:
Arredondado - Exatamente o que está escrito
Retangular - Definido em outro lugar
Seta - indica a sequência possível
Alvo - final válido
Nova Linha
Aumentar recuo
Diminuir recuo
5
. Observações
Um elemento de um Diagrama Sintático - Diagrama de Sintaxe pode ser uma expressão regular
Quando todos os elementos de um conjunto devem aparecer independente da ordem usamos uma lista não ordenada
Desenhado com auxílio de
componente BNF -> Diagrama Sintático
.
Arquivo origem:
DiagramaSintaticoConvencao.xml
.
Diagrama Sintático - Convenções do desenho {5}
Exemplo
Exemplo com legenda
Formas de percurso
Definição dos elementos
Observações
Índice Local {8}
Qualidade {2}
5W2H
PDCA
Paletas {10}
Mais utilizadas
Apoie
Apresentação e Componentes
Diagramas
Diagrama Sintático
Dojo
Logos
Projetos
Setas
Tecnologias
Linguagem
{3}
Erlang Quick Sort
LDC
Definição {10}
Erlang
Python 3.0
Ruby 1.9.1 - Sintaxe
Ruby 1.9.1 - Léxico
Shell
Javascript
Lua
PHP
XML
LazyBnf
Método {3}
Serviço Web
Diagrama Warnier/Orr
Simples x Complexo
Componente {4}
ExibirLinguagem.htm
Gerar Páginas
Lista
Tabela de Decisões
Projeto Apoie {3}
Projeto Apoie
Serviço Web
Personagens e Relacionamentos
Evento {4}
Pendência
Estados da Informação
Scrum
Prioridade
Dojo {3}
Coding Dojo
Formatos
Soluções Coding Dojo {6}
#34 Expressão Aritmética
#33 Impedimento
#32 Sequência Numérica
#31 Tráfego
#29 Boliche
#28 Jogo da Vida